What began as a series of revival movements seeking to renew stagnant expressions of Christianity eventually gave rise to American evangelicalism. As historian Aaron Griffith notes, these renewal efforts not only shaped many evangelical denominations of the 18th and 19th centuries but continue to define evangelical identity today.
In this episode of Today’s Conversation podcast, Aaron Griffith and NAE President Walter Kim explore how historical forces and social dynamics influenced denominational development, public life and the Church’s witness.
